OVer the past few weeks, which were starting weeks for me, SLA were shortened to 1 hour, shifts scrambled and turned up to 12 hours each, a new task tracking system introduced, and then everything reverted within 2 weeks, all without considering employees' lives. They need to consider the humans.

They have 0 retention, and 0 focus on the human aspect of work. We're being told we should act like machines in a factory assembly line, and the whole work structure is centered around that idea. Also, work culture is rather solitary even by remote work standards, and no effort is put to change it.

All kind of bureaucracy, where I have to fill inputs, which nobody will read, use or even be able to understand, make me feel I'm not using my skills, and I am undervalued. Compensation simply needs to be adjusted, because the market of remote work has grown, and I already can find an equal offer.

The tracker needs to stop counting time I spend off-keyboard as idle time, and proper linux support for it should be introduced. Also, I'd very much like more challenging work, as the work I do right now is utterly meaningless for me. and is far beneath my qualification.

It's very solitary! Less focus on metrics at the cost of the contributors' mental health. More engaging work, more focus on team activity even if it introduces waste and redundancy. I'd like to see some pair coding, or a day in which we revise our codebase together and make it better, etc.

Remote work is hard. The company acknowledges that. The work to mitigate the productivity loss is not being done. The overwhelming, and obvious, feature that results is that good people are overloaded and they, along with many others do just enough to move things off their desk rather than finish it
